Here are some tips that can help you save energy, primarily by making your cooking area more green.

Refrigerators and freezers use a lot of electricity, especially if they are not running as economically as they should. When you can get a new one, they use about 60% less than the old versions that happen to be more than ten years old. Keeping the temperature of the fridge at 37F, in conjunction with 0F for the freezer, will save on electricity, while keeping food at the correct temperature. Checking that the condenser is clean, which means that the motor needs to operate less frequently, will also save electricity.

The ingredients needed to prepare Tex's St. George's Mixed Grill πŸ„πŸ·πŸ‘ πŸ„πŸ…πŸ³πŸ‡¬πŸ‡§:
  1. Prepare 140 grams rump steak
  2. Provide 1-2 lamb chops
  3. Use 100 grams lamb's liver
  4. You need 2 rashers smoked bacon
  5. Use 1-2 pork or beef sausages (bangers)
  6. Use 1 large free-range egg
  7. Take 1-2 large mushrooms
  8. Get 1 tomato (sliced in two)
  9. Provide As needed oil for shallow frying
  10. Get As needed salt and black pepper to season
  11. Get As needed fresh finely chopped basil (optional)
  12. Use As needed fresh finely chopped mint (optional)
  13. Take As needed flour for breading
Steps to make Tex's St. George's Mixed Grill πŸ„πŸ·πŸ‘ πŸ„πŸ…πŸ³πŸ‡¬πŸ‡§:
  1. The choice for your grill is up to you. The basic is usually several cuts of meat (including at least one cutlet or chop), bacon, sausage, and offal (kidneys or liver).
  2. The mixed grill is usually served with mushrooms, tomatoes, fried egg, and often black pudding, a few chips and/or baked beans;
  3. The ingredients are all easy enough to cook, it's the timing that's the problem with a mixed grill…
  4. Put your liver in a bowl
  5. Cover with milk and allow to sit for at least 1 hour, preferably overnight. This will draw out the bitterness many people complain about when eating liver
  6. Preheat the oven to gas mark 5, 190Β°C (375Β°F). Brush the mushrooms inside and out with oil or butter, then season
  7. Begin frying your sausage and mushrooms in the skillet turning occasionally, on a medium heat. Do not pierce the sausage, or the fat and flavour will leak from the banger in to the pan
  8. After the sausage has been cooking for four minutes remove the mushrooms and put in the oven. Add the bacon to the skillet. Slice the tomato in half, season, sprinkle the sliced side with chopped basil, then add to the skillet flat side down.
  9. Dry the liver on kitchen paper, season, and coat in flour.
  10. When the bacon and tomato has been cooking for 3 minutes, turn
  11. After another 3 minutes turn the oven down to gas mark 2, 150Β°C (300Β°F) and put all the contents of the skillet into the oven with the mushrooms
  12. Increase the heat of the skillet to high until smoking. Season the steak and lamb on both sides. Sprinkle the chop(s) liberally with chopped mint, then pop in the pan, along with the steak and the liver
  13. Cook the liver for about 1Β½ minutes each side then set aside. Fry the steak and chop for 4-5 minutes then turn, cook for another 4-5 minutes then test with your finger to see if it's done to your taste. When it's cooked correctly, turn off the oven. Keep the steak, liver, and lamb in the oven to rest. Turn the heat in the skillet down to medium-low and crack in your egg
  14. Add the rest of the contents of the oven (except the chops, steak, and liver) to the skillet with the egg
  15. When the egg is cooked, remove the skillet from the heat and begin plating up
